Translate Vindicate To English

Translate

Click Translate to learn how to say vindicate in English

Translating vindicate to English

Our online Spanish to English translator, will help you to achieve the best Spanish to English translation over the Internet - translate a single word from Spanish to English or a full text translation with a click


Related Terms

assert
bear out
contend
disprove
explain
free
guard
justify
let off
purge
revenge
support
uphold
whitewash